بَابُ السَّهْوِ فِي الْفَجْرِ وَ الْمَغْرِبِ وَ الْجُمُعَةِ

alkafi-5145

عَلِيُّ بْنُ إِبْرَاهِيمَ عَنْ أَبِيهِ وَ م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 إِسْمَاعِيلَ عَنِ الْفَضْلِ بْنِ شَاذَانَ جَمِيعاً عَنِ ابْنِ أَبِي عُمَيْرٍ عَنْ حَفْصِ بْنِ الْبَخْتَرِيِّ وَ غَيْرِهِ عَنْ أَبِي ع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ع قَالَ:

إِذَا شَكَكْتَ فِي الْمَغْرِبِ فَأَعِدْ وَ إِذَا شَكَكْتَ فِي الْفَجْرِ فَأَعِدْ.

1. Ali ibn Ibrahim has narrated from his father from and Muhammad ibn ’Isma‘il from af-Fadf ibn Shadhan all from Ibn Abi ‘Umayr from Hafs ibn al-Bakhtariy and others who has said the following: “Ab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), has said, ‘If you doubt in al-Maghrib Salah (prayer) perform it again. If you doubt in the morning Salah (prayer) perform it again.’”

عَلِيُّ بْنُ إِبْرَاهِيمَ عَنْ أَبِيهِ عَنْ حَمَّادٍ عَنْ حَرِيزٍ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 مُسْلِمٍ قَالَ:

سَأَلْتُ أَبَا ع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ع عَنِ الرَّجُلِ يُصَلِّي وَ لَا يَدْرِي وَاحِدَةً صَلَّى أَمْ ثِنْتَيْنِ قَالَ يَسْتَقْبِلُ‌ حَتَّى يَسْتَيْقِنَ أَنَّهُ قَدْ أَتَمَّ وَ فِي الْجُمُعَةِ وَ فِي الْمَغْرِبِ وَ فِي الصَّلَاةِ فِي السَّفَرِ.

2. Ali ibn Ibrahim has narrated from his father from Hammad, from Hariz from Muhammad ibn Muslim who has said the following: “I once asked ab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), about a man who performs Salah (prayer) but does not know if he has performed one or two (Rak‘at). He (the Imam) said, ‘He performs it again to ascertain that he has completed it and so also is the case with Friday, al-Maghrib and Salah (prayer) on a journey.’”

الْحُسَيْنُ بْنُ مُحَمَّدٍ الْأَشْعَرِيُّ ع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عَامِرٍ عَنْ عَلِيِّ بْنِ مَهْزِيَارَ عَنْ فَضَالَةَ بْنِ أَيُّوبَ عَنْ سَيْفِ بْنِ عَمِيرَةَ عَنْ أَبِي بَكْرٍ الْحَضْرَمِيِّ قَالَ:

صَلَّيْتُ بِأَصْحَابِيَ الْمَغْرِبَ فَلَمَّا أَنْ صَلَّيْتُ رَكْعَتَيْنِ سَلَّمْتُ فَقَالَ بَعْضُهُمْ إِنَّمَا صَلَّيْتَ رَكْعَتَيْنِ فَأَعَدْتُ فَأَخْبَرْتُ أَبَا ع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ع فَقَالَ لَعَلَّكَ أَعَدْتَ قُلْتُ نَعَمْ قَالَ فَضَحِكَ ثُمَّ قَالَ إِنَّمَا يُجْزِئُكَ أَنْ تَقُومَ فَتَرْكَعَ رَكْعَةً.

3. Al-Husayn ibn Muhammad al-Ash’ariy has narrated from ‘Abd Allah ibn ‘Amir from Ali ibn Mahziyar from Fadalah ibn Ayyub from Sayf ibn ‘Amirah from abu Bakr al-Hadramiy who has said the following: “I once performed al-Maghrib Salah (prayer) with my people but after two Rak‘at I said the phrase of offering greeting of peace and someone from them said, ‘You performed only two Rak‘at.’ I performed it again. I then informed ab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), about it and he said, ‘Perhaps you performed it again.’ I said, ‘Yes, I did so.’ He (the narrator) has said that he (the Imam) smiled and said, ‘You only had to stand up and perform one Rak‘at.’”

عَلِيُّ بْنُ إِبْرَاهِيمَ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 عِيسَى عَنْ يُونُسَ عَنْ رَجُلٍ عَنْ أَبِي ع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ع قَالَ:

لَيْسَ فِي الْمَغْرِبِ وَ الْفَجْرِ سَهْوٌ.

4. Ali ibn Ibrahim has narrated from Muhammad ibn ‘Isa from Yunus from a man who has said the following: “Abu ‘Abd Allah (a.s.), has said, ‘There is no confusion (acceptable) in al-Maghrib and morning Salah (prayer).”’
